2008 Estate Petite Sirah

Price: Sold Out

A big juicy Petite Sirah with bold dark fruit in the mid palate with just the right amount of black licorice finishes with a long lingering mocha.

This wine pairs with big flavorful dishes such a lamp, duck, or wild game but sips so well you don’t have to have food with it but try it with a nice brie cheese.
  • 2008 Vintage
  • Fair Play Appellation
  • 14.1% Alcohol
  • 100% Petite Sirah
  • Aged in combination of new and neutral Hungarian and American Oak
  • 21 cases produced

2008 Petite Sirah (Late Harvest)

Price: $23.00

Our newest dessert wine is a late harvest Petite Sirah. It has wonderful deep rich black cherry and black currant flavors with a hint of mocha and a long lingering finish.

Enjoy with dark chocolate as a dessert wine or a nice cheddar or blue cheese for an afternoon refresher.
  • 2008 Vintage
  • Fair Play Appellation
  • 18% Alcohol
  • 4.5% Residual Sugar
  • 120 cases produced
